Transaction 74d3ff0298f70878b61973e324685bcdd4edf62ff9c0366aa696ae107c4f0547

7 Input
2 Outputs
  • 74d3ff0298f70878b61973e324685bcdd4edf62ff9c0366aa696ae107c4f0547:0
  • value  990745
    address  3Ms1dqYPMZ72nETiuS2fF4Mi1tWFVzUcKU
  • 74d3ff0298f70878b61973e324685bcdd4edf62ff9c0366aa696ae107c4f0547:1
  • value  2046750
    address  143A3UY4ACQKbQgSwNtByP66AwdwFHxiY7